Nagam Janardhan Reddy to serve no-confidence notice against Government over Telangana issue
Hyderabad
Suspended Telugu Desam Party leader Nagam Janardhan Reddy and TDP MLAs HareeswarReddy and Jogu Raamanna has served no-confidence motion against the Government on Telangana issue. Speaking to the media at media point, Nagam Janardhan Reddy said that they are serving no-confidence motion against the Government as the council of ministers and the Government is showing discrimination against people of Telangana region.
Janardhan Reddy has sought the support of all political parties and Telangana leaders to the no-confidence motion. The notice will be handed over to the Secretary to the State Legislature G Raja Sadaram.
